If you want to establish your online business and start selling online, you have basically two options:

Selling form your own store

Selling via marketplace

Selling from your own store means you buy domain and hosting and create your own online store. If you want to sell from your own store, you have two options, either to build your own inventory or dropship. Building inventory means you buy or develop products and sell fro your store. Droship means products for other companies.

Selling via marketplace means you set up your store on marketplaces like facebook marketplace, ebay, Amazon. Zazzle, Etsy, etc. and start selling from these platforms. You don’t have to spend money to build your store, but you need to spend money to list your product or pay commission on sales.

Droppshipping and selling through marketplace are cheaper options compared to building your inventory and selling your own products.

I have a blog, it generates referral traffic as well as organic traffic. I earn from ad ads, I use infolinks, adsnese, and A-ads. I earn $50 per month by using these different ad networks. While A-Ads send me daily payment, I have to wait for 3 months to reach $50 on infolinks and get paid after 45 days. It takes 3-4 months for me to reach the payment threshold on Adsense. Since I was already earning from ads, I tried affiliate marketing but did not make any sales even in one month. I also added digital products for sale and was unsuccessful.

Whether you're a small business owner looking to expand your reach or an entrepreneur with a great idea, selling online is a great way to grow your business. But how do you get started?

Here are a few tips to get you started on selling online:

1. Find your niche.

The first step to selling online is finding your niche. What products or services do you offer that others don't? What can you provide that will appeal to a specific group of people?

Answering these questions will help you focus your online selling efforts and make it more likely that you'll be successful.

2. Build a website.

Once you've found your niche, the next step is to build a website. Your website is your online store, so it's important to make sure it's user-friendly and attractive.

There are a number of different ways to build a website, so you'll need to do some research to find the best option for your business. Once your website is up and running, you can start adding products and services.

3. Choose the right platform.

There are a number of different platforms you can use to sell online, and it's important to choose the right one for your business. Do some research to compare the different options and find the one that offers the best features and support for your needs.

4. Promote your business.

Once you've got everything set up, it's time to start promoting your business. There are a number of ways to do this, including social media, search engine optimization, and pay-per-click advertising.
